BTL & Ambient Advertising Overview

Here is a breakdown of three innovative ambient OOH campaigns featuring dynamic engineering, interactive technologies, and real-time environmental activation.

MINI Cooper: Unlimited Agility & AR Experience

To demonstrate MINI Cooper’s agility and its ability to handle any road or terrain, this ambient outdoor installation featured a dramatic 3D loop-the-loop track breaking out of the standard billboard frame. To extend physical engagement into the digital space, the billboard incorporated an Augmented Reality (AR) trigger. By pointing a smartphone camera at the display, users unlocked exclusive 3D animations of the MINI tackling the loop alongside dynamic advertising content.

  • Concept & Spatial Design: Engineered an eye-catching 3D looping track structure that physically visualizes MINI’s core attribute of driving anywhere without limits.
  • Augmented Reality Integration: Developed an interactive AR layer accessible via mobile phones, delivering real-time animated sequences and interactive media directly over the physical installation.
  • Phygital Engagement: Merged outdoor spatial installation with mobile interactive technology to transform a passive display into an engaging viral experience.

Rain-Activated Foaming Beer Glass

This dynamic OOH installation brought the iconic Bud glass to life by turning urban rainfall into an engaging creative trigger. The top of the 3D beer glass was built with a custom perforation system housing a completely safe, non-toxic reactive agent. Whenever rain fell, water entered through the top vents, triggering a reaction that produced rich, realistic beer foam spilling over the edge of the glass in real time.

  • Weather-Responsive Activation: Built an environmental installation that physically reacted to natural rainfall without requiring electronic sensors or manual controls.
  • Safe Foam Generation: Formulated an eco-friendly, non-toxic material setup integrated behind top perforations to reliably produce realistic beer foam upon contact with water.
  • Contextual Brand Narrative: Turned gloomy rainy weather into a surprising, perfectly timed visual highlight that entertained pedestrians and drivers.

MTS: Seamless Network Connection on the Go

For MTS, Moscow's leading telecom operator, the goal was to demonstrate flawless mobile network coverage even inside high-speed underground subway trains ("Catches Connection Everywhere!"). The billboard utilized dynamic kinetic engineering featuring a custom motorized scrolling mechanism that physically moved a subway car across the display in continuous motion, creating a vivid illusion of a train traveling in real time.

  • Kinetic Motion Mechanism: Designed a custom motorized mechanical billboard featuring a continuous rolling belt to drive physical moving train elements.
  • Direct Visual Metaphor: Instantly communicated seamless mobile network reliability inside underground subway systems through continuous physical movement.
  • High-Impact Traffic Visibility: Engineered for maximum visibility on high-traffic urban routes, ensuring dynamic motion grabbed driver attention immediately.
